🍓 Strawberry Banana Crunch Banana Pudding

* 2 boxes (5.1 oz) instant vanilla pudding

* 3½ cups cold milk

* 1 (14 oz) can sweetened condensed milk

* 8 oz cream cheese, softened

* 2 cups heavy whipping cream

* ¾ cup powdered sugar

* 1 tsp vanilla bean paste

* 4-5 bananas, sliced

* 1 lb fresh strawberries, diced

* 2 boxes Nilla Wafers

Strawberry Crunch

* 1 package Golden Oreos, crushed

* 1 (3 oz) box strawberry Jell-O powder

* 5 tbsp melted butter

Mix the crushed Oreos, Jell-O powder, and melted butter until crumbly. Let cool completely before using.

Instructions

1. Whisk the pudding mix and cold milk together until thickened.

2. Beat the cream cheese and sweetened condensed milk until smooth, then mix into the pudding.

3. In a separate bowl, whip the heavy cream, powdered sugar, and vanilla bean paste until stiff peaks form. Fold into the pudding mixture until light and fluffy.

4. Fold the diced strawberries into the pudding mixture.

5. In your serving dish, layer Nilla Wafers, pudding, banana slices, and strawberry crunch. Repeat the layers until the dish is full.

6. Finish with a thick layer of homemade whipped cream, sprinkle generously with strawberry crunch, and decorate the edges with Nilla Wafers if desired.

7. Chill for at least 6 hours, or overnight for the best flavor and texture.

... Read moreMaking strawberry banana crunch pudding is a wonderful way to combine fresh, healthy ingredients with a satisfying crunchy texture. In my experience, the key to this dessert’s success lies in layering: starting with a creamy banana pudding base, then adding a generous amount of fresh sliced strawberries to enhance the natural sweetness and tartness. The crunch element typically comes from crushed cookies, granola, or even toasted nuts sprinkled on top, which adds an appealing contrast to the smooth pudding. One tip I found particularly helpful is to prepare the pudding a few hours ahead of time and refrigerate it.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ully, and the texture becomes even more luscious. When serving, adding a few whole strawberry slices or a mint leaf can elevate the presentation, making it visually inviting. This dessert is perfect not only for sharing with friends but also for enjoying as a light but indulgent treat after a meal. Plus, it’s versatile—you can easily customize it by swapping in your favorite berries or crunchy toppings. Whether you’re looking for a quick dessert to whip up or a make-ahead treat to impress guests, strawberry banana crunch pudding offers a delightful balance of creamy, fruity, and crunchy sensations that are sure to please anyone’s palate.
